Grand Theft Auto: Vice City is no stranger to wild, over-the-top modding. While many focus on enhancing the 80s aesthetic or adding modern cars, some modders took a radically different path, transforming the neon-soaked streets of Vice City into a battleground for, or a total conversion of, the iconic AvP universe. The mod (often referred to as an "AvP" total conversion or skin pack) brings the terrifying Xenomorphs and elite Yautja hunters into the world of Tommy Vercetti.

The "story" in this mod is loosely defined compared to the original game, as it primarily replaces character models and assets rather than creating an entirely new narrative campaign.

This mod is a prime example of the "bootleg" gaming culture of the early 2000s. While it wasn't a professional product, it gained a cult following for its bizarre but entertaining mashup of two beloved franchises. Today, you can still find gameplay showcases and walk-throughs of this "strangest mod" on platforms like YouTube .
